This card continues the flavor of powerful positional Hunter spells. With one card, you can destroy two minions for high card efficiency. Compared to  Assassinate, long considered the baseline for Destroy effects, Crushing Walls has twice the value for only three more mana.

However, the high cost of Crushing Walls and its ease to play around means that you usually spend your entire turn playing it and give your opponent another turn to refresh their board, making this a hard card to use.  Deadly Shot is usually a better card, since it's cheap removal that can't be played around.

In order to play around Crushing Walls, just summon smaller minions to the outermost edges of your board. Be aware, however, that this leaves you vulnerable to  Explosive Shot.
